Review of Drop Dead Gorgeous (1999) by Williamw. — 08 Sep 2005
Underrated. The reception of this movie is a perfect example of how less-than-bright, thin-skinned, lily-livered critics destroy perfectly enjoyable movies because they don't like people being "mean" or because the characters aren't "likable.
" This film is careful to establish its tone from the beginning and never backs down from it: it is viciously satirical, but it is viciously satirical from start to finish without ever backing down.
And still it manages to have poignant moments--due mostly to great acting, especially from Barken, Janney and Alley. A thoroughly enjoyable and hilarious film--I'm just sorry I had to wait til it ended up in a box of VHS tapes a friend was selling in a garage sale before I saw it.
